Output a831f9000893e160d4bc332645620583102bd295d89d5aa1f0a5944a653d82ab:1

value
22959854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d940f28da3f7c923dcfdacb5f25deffed135cdd5 OP_EQUAL
address
3MVkMoPHKYWLW54u17TXURUUGQf1TY1DQR
transaction
a831f9000893e160d4bc332645620583102bd295d89d5aa1f0a5944a653d82ab
spent
true